Posted by nigelrmtaylor on Mar. 13 2006,12:38
Hi

I think I'm going through a similar process to you at the moment.

I've just setup a raid1 (syncing at the moment).

In outline this is what I did:
1) did a hard disk install onto one of the disks
2) created a big partition on both disks for the raid using cfdisk - I set the type to bf FD just for good measure
3) copied the mkraid and raidstart executables from a knoppix installation and put them into /opt on the hard disk along with a raidtab file that defined the raid
4) ran mkraid to create the raid
5) updated the bootlocal.sh script to run raidstart at boot time

let me know if you need more info
